A healthcare provider in Doncaster is seeking to employ clinical staff to provide high-quality assessment and treatment for patients. The role requires collaboration with clinical teams, decision-making skills, and adherence to confidentiality and safety regulations. Employees will manage both acute and chronic conditions, integrating various treatment methods.

This position offers access to the NHS Pension Scheme and 27 days of annual leave. An inclusive environment is promoted, valuing diversity within the workforce.
